Hi everyone,
I'm thinking of getting a new Acer Aspire (V3-771G-7361161.12TMakk to be exact) and I'd like to get some more information before taking the plunge.
The laptop is listed as having a 1TB HDD and a 120GB SSD, are those separate disks or a dingle hybrid? Is there a spare bay available to put in another drive?
I've had issues with dust accumulating inside my old laptop. How difficult is it to open and clean the Aspire?
em 09-04-2013 09:03 PM
The drives in the specific model that you are looking at are two separate drives.
There are only two bays in the unit.
We do not recommend attempting to disassemble the unit.
